The Crossing Fonds research team would like to announce a critical digital archives symposium in Metro Vancouver and online from April 25-28, 2024 and invite short student presentations (proposals due February 29).  


Pre-symposium workshops will include hands-on training in collaborative annotation, visualization, and cataloguing tools. Speakers will explore topics such as archival ethics of care, data visualization, Indigenous data sovereignty, collaborative tools and methods, community-centred collections created for and with equity-deserving communities, and more. Panels feature archival projects from IBPOC, queer and trans, and disabled communities. Evening receptions, exhibitions, and film screenings will take place at VIVO Media Arts and the Black Arts Centre. Explore the program here: https://crossingfonds.com/program/  


Keynotes include: 

ˇ              Dr. Marian Dörk (Fachhochschule Potsdam University of Applied Sciences) 

ˇ              Donna Sacuta (BC Labour Heritage Centre) 

ˇ              Dr. Kristin Kozar (UBC Indian Residential School History and Dialogue Centre) 

ˇ              Dr. Michelle Caswell (UCLA School of Education and Information Studies) 

ˇ              Ry Moran (U Vic Libraries Executive, Reconciliation)
